Rebecca Ferguson Opens Up on “Scary” On-Set Confrontation

Rebecca Ferguson revealed details about a frightening confrontation she experienced on set several years ago, shedding light on the challenges actors can face behind the scenes. The Dune star reflected on the hostile encounter with an unidentified co-star, describing how she would handle such tension differently today amid evolving Hollywood attitudes.

Rebecca Ferguson’s Reflection on the Distressing Incident

Two years after first revealing that she was once yelled at by a costar during filming, Rebecca Ferguson spoke more openly about the event in a recent interview with Harper’s Bazaar. The 42-year-old actress shared that the episode was terrifying and deeply personal rather than connected to the other individual involved.

It was about me. It was so scary. I didn’t know then how to go, ‘Hey, can I talk to you privately?’ Now, I would want to believe I could have taken this person aside.

– Rebecca Ferguson, Actress

Ferguson emphasized how the shifting cultural dynamics within Hollywood have given her greater confidence to stand up for herself now than she had at the time of the incident. She expressed support for the growing awareness in the industry, which she believes needs to find a balanced approach.

A lot of people say that we’ve become too woke, but I think, no, it’s great,

she said.

The pendulum needs to swing to the other side so we can find a balance in between.

– Rebecca Ferguson, Actress

Though she has never revealed the identity of the costar who confronted her, Ferguson clarified it was not past co-stars Tom Cruise or Hugh Jackman. After disclosing the story in 2024, she received extensive public support.

Support From Fellow Actors and Personal Impact

Among those expressing solidarity was Dwayne “The Rock” Johnson, Ferguson’s Hercules co-star, who publicly praised her for standing up against mistreatment on set.

Hate seeing this but love seeing her stand up to bulls–t,

Johnson wrote on social media.

Rebecca was my guardian angel sent from heaven on our set. I love that woman.

Dwayne Johnson, Actor

Rebecca, who balances her career with raising two children—a 7-year-old daughter with husband Rory St. Clair Gainer and a 19-year-old son, Isac, with ex Ludwig Hallberg—acknowledged in an interview with The Times that others who worked with the individual also had negative experiences.

Other people who have worked with this person also had a s—ty time.

– Rebecca Ferguson, Actress

Despite highlighting the person’s behavior publicly, Ferguson noted that she has not been contacted by them and does not expect reconciliation.

We put a lot of blame on bullies and when we get older we can understand that people are insecure,

she reflected.

When you start standing up for yourself, it’s really tricky. They’ll fire you and give the job to someone else.

– Rebecca Ferguson, Actress

Drama Among Queer Eye Cast: Tan France and Bobby Berk

Bobby Berk publicly addressed rumors about his falling out with Tan France after announcing his departure from Queer Eye in January 2024. He clarified the disagreement was personal and unrelated to the show.

I want people to know that Tan and I—we will be fine,

Berk told Vanity Fair.

There was a situation, and that’s between Tan and I, and it has nothing to do with the show. It was something personal that had been brewing—and nothing romantic, just to clarify that.

– Bobby Berk, Designer and TV Personality

Tan France responded in March 2024 to accusations that he pushed for a replacement on the show with Jeremiah Brent, a friend of his. He denied any involvement and explained the casting was a typical process.

Netflix and the production companies did a full-on casting. I didn’t put my friend up for the job. They ended up getting it because they were the best person for the job,

he said.

But I didn’t get them hired by getting rid of somebody else.

– Tan France, TV Personality

Sharon Osbourne’s Criticism of Ashton Kutcher

In September 2023, Sharon Osbourne labeled Ashton Kutcher as the rudest celebrity she ever met during an E! News segment with her daughter Kelly Osbourne. She described Kutcher as a

“rude, rude, rude, rude little boy”

and a “dastardly little thing.” Kutcher did not respond publicly.

Reflecting on a 2014 incident on The Talk, Osbourne recalled Kutcher’s confrontational attitude when she mispronounced his name.

He goes, ‘What are you, what have you done in this industry?’

she recounted.

And I was like, ‘Kid, don’t start with me, because I’m gonna eat you up and s–t you out.’ So I was just like, ‘You don’t know what you’re dealing with, kid.’

– Sharon Osbourne, TV Personality

Dwayne Johnson and Tyrese Gibson’s Public Dispute

Tensions flared between co-stars Dwayne Johnson and Tyrese Gibson surrounding the Fast and Furious franchise. The conflict escalated when the release date for Fast and Furious 9 was delayed, and a spinoff starring Johnson and Jason Statham was announced for 2019. Tyrese even threatened to quit if Johnson remained on the cast.

On The Red Pill podcast, Tyrese admitted he had not yet spoken directly with Johnson but intended to.

I have yet to talk to The Rock to this day, and we will have a conversation.

– Tyrese Gibson, Actor and Musician

I found myself being the messenger on behalf of various people associated to the franchise, but stupid me was the only one who went public about those feelings, which is my own fault,

Tyrese acknowledged.

It’s not professional, it’s not cool.

– Tyrese Gibson, Actor and Musician

Nicki Minaj and Cardi B’s High-Profile Altercation

The 2018 New York Fashion Week saw a public altercation between Nicki Minaj and Cardi B at the Harper’s Bazaar Icon party. Cardi later explained the build-up to their feud, which involved ongoing disparagement and social media disputes.

For a while now she’s been taking a lot of shots at me,

Cardi said.

I spoke to her twice before, and we came to an understanding. But she kept it going.

– Cardi B, Rapper

The final spark was triggered by Cardi perceiving that Nicki had liked and then unliked a tweet questioning her parenting, which Nicki denied.

I was going to make millions off my Bruno Mars tour, and I sacrificed that to stay with my daughter,

Cardi added.

I love my daughter. I’m a good-ass f–king mom. So for somebody that don’t have a child to like that comment? So many people want to say that party wasn’t the time or the place, but I’m not going to catch another artist in the grocery store or down the block.

– Cardi B, Rapper
